The Existential Crisis of Peter Parker

Spider-Man 2 transcends typical superhero fare by deeply exploring Peter Parker's internal struggles. The film masterfully portrays his growing disillusionment with the sacrifices required by his dual identity. Peter grapples with the loss of his personal life, the strain on his relationships, and the overwhelming responsibility of protecting New York City.

This existential crisis leads him to question the very essence of his powers and whether he can continue to bear the weight of being Spider-Man. His journey of self-doubt and eventual rediscovery of his purpose is what makes the narrative so compelling and relatable, even for those without superpowers.

The Tragic Fall of Dr. Otto Octavius

Dr. Otto Octavius, portrayed with chilling complexity by Alfred Molina, serves as a perfect foil to Spider-Man. His transformation from a brilliant, benevolent scientist into the destructive Doctor Octopus is a cautionary tale about unchecked ambition and the devastating consequences of scientific hubris.

The accident that fuses him with his mechanical arms is not just a physical change but a psychological descent. His motivations, initially driven by a desire to advance science, become corrupted by the power and the influence of his enhanced limbs, leading him down a path of villainy that Spider-Man must confront, highlighting the thin line between genius and madness.

Crafting a Cinematic Masterpiece

The production of Spider-Man 2 was a monumental undertaking, commencing principal photography in April 2003. Filmed across the vibrant landscapes of New York City and Los Angeles, the movie utilized these urban environments to create a sense of scale and immersion. The visual effects were groundbreaking for their time, earning an Academy Award.

This involved intricate CGI for web-slinging sequences, realistic physics simulations for the characters' movements, and detailed creation of Doctor Octopus's mechanical arms. Danny Elfman's return to compose the score further enhanced the film's dramatic impact, weaving a sonic tapestry that perfectly complemented the on-screen action and emotional depth.

Enduring Legacy and Multiversal Connections

Spider-Man 2 is widely regarded as a benchmark in the superhero genre, celebrated for its sophisticated storytelling, character development, and technical achievements. Its critical and commercial success, grossing nearly $800 million worldwide, solidified its place as a top film of 2004 and influenced subsequent superhero blockbusters. The film's impact extends beyond its initial release; the concept of the multiverse, explored in the MCU film Spider-Man: No Way Home (2021), brought back Tobey Maguire and Alfred Molina, directly connecting this beloved installment to a larger cinematic universe and proving its lasting cultural significance.
